Early Handguns: Flintlocks and Percussion Cap Pistols
Flintlock Pistols (17th - nineteenth Century)

Overview: Flintlock pistols were amongst the initial hand-held firearms, making use of a flint putting system to ignite gunpowder.
Capabilities:
Ignition: Flint hanging metal to build sparks.
Reload Time: Long and cumbersome, usually requiring numerous measures.
Impression: Utilised thoroughly in navy and personal protection, environment the phase for long term developments.
Percussion Cap Pistols (nineteenth Century)

Overview: Percussion cap pistols replaced flintlocks, offering enhanced dependability and quicker ignition.
Attributes:
Ignition: Percussion cap struck by a hammer to ignite gunpowder.
Reload Time: More quickly than flintlocks but still labor-intense.
Influence: Extensively adopted in armed service and civilian use, paving the way for more economical firing mechanisms.
The Advent of Revolvers
Colt Paterson Revolver (1836)

Overview: The Colt Paterson was the primary commercially successful revolving-cylinder handgun, invented by Samuel Colt.
Functions:
Potential: 5 to six rounds.
Reload Time: More quickly than one-shot pistols but needed disassembly.
Impression: Revolutionized particular firearms, introducing the idea of numerous pictures with out reloading.
Colt Solitary Motion Military (1873)

Overview: Generally known as the “Peacemaker,” this revolver became iconic while in the American West.
Features:
Ability: six rounds.
Reload Time: Single-motion system expected guide cocking for every shot.
Affect: Grew to become a normal for legislation enforcement and navy, influencing potential revolver models.
The Rise of Semi-Automated Pistols
Mauser C96 (1896)

Overview: One of the first successful semi-computerized pistols, the Mauser C96 highlighted an interior journal.
Capabilities:
Capability: ten rounds.
Reload Time: More rapidly with stripper clips but expected handbook biking.
Effect: Showcased the prospective of semi-automated technological innovation in handguns.
Colt M1911 (1911)

Overview: Made by John Browning, the M1911 grew to become the normal-concern sidearm to the U.S. armed forces.
Functions:
Capability: 7+one rounds.
Reload Time: Speedy with removable Publications.
Affect: Renowned for trustworthiness and halting electric power, placing a benchmark for foreseeable future pistols.
Modern day Handguns
Glock 17 (1982)

Overview: The Glock seventeen launched polymer frames as well as a striker-fired mechanism, revolutionizing fashionable handgun style and design.
Characteristics:
Capability: seventeen+1 rounds.
Frame: Light-weight polymer.
Security: Integrated induce security.
Influence: Popularized using polymers in handguns, resulting in widespread adoption by regulation enforcement and civilians.
Sig Sauer P320 (2014)

Overview: The modular design and style of the P320 will allow end users to customize grip dimensions, frame, and caliber.
Options:
Capability: Varies by design (up to seventeen+1 rounds).
Modularity: Interchangeable parts for customization.
Impression: Adopted through the U.S. military since the M17/M18, showcasing the future of customizable handguns.
